Chimamanda has also become famous for a TedTalk she delivered some years ago. In this talk, she describes the way her personal life and the culture she belongs to affect the way she writes. She particularly addresses the risks of being exposed to only one single point of view about a certain topic; in this case, our opinion on African culture.
